background image

 

1 Port RS232 Card 

Chapter 2  

  7 

Chapter 2 
Hardware Configuration 

Hardware Configuration 

This chapter details the specifications of the PCI 1 Port RS232 card. This half-
sized card will work happily in any PCI 2.0 or greater compliant PC compatible. 

General Card Features. 

A 9 pin D RS232 Serial port. 

Reliable communications up to 50 feet, 15m, and beyond! 

Word length of 5, 6, 7 or 8 bits. 

Even, Odd, None, Mark or Space parity options.  

1 start bit always sent. 

1, (1.5 for 5-bit data word length) or 2 stop bits.  

Full modem control TXD, RXD, DSR, DCD, DTR, RTS, CTS and RI  signals. 

Fully double buffered for reliable asynchronous operation. 

High-speed integrated circuitry ensures operation with fast PC’s e.g.700MHz 
PentiumIII WITHOUT extra wait states. 

16C550 FIFO provides 16-byte input and 16-byte output buffer on each port. 

Maximum baud rate of 115,200 Baud. 

Clock input of 1.8432 Mhz 

Summary of Contents for 1 Port Rs232 Card

Page 1: ...Brain Boxes 1 Port Rs232 Card By Paul D Sinclair...

Page 2: ...ing The 1 Port RS232 Card In The Computer 9 STEP 1 Remove Cover Mounting Screws 9 STEP 2 Remove The PC Cover 9 STEP 3 Remove the Blanking Cover 10 STEP 4 Insert The Card 10 STEP 5 Secure the Card into...

Page 3: ...ager 37 Chapter 8 Windows NT4 Installation 41 Introduction 41 Driver Installation 41 Checking Your Installation 42 Port Configuration 43 Advanced Port Settings 45 Uninstalling Serial Solutions PCI 45...

Page 4: ...uivalent unit COPYRIGHT COPYRIGHT 1985 2000 BRAIN BOXES LIMITED All rights reserved No part of this hardware circuitry or manual may be duplicated copied transmitted or reproduced in any way without t...

Page 5: ......

Page 6: ...tions drivers have the following features Drivers for PC FIFO UARTs e g 16550 as well as the new improved 32 byte 16650 and 64 byte 16750 UARTs Support for any mix of RS232 RS422 and RS485 handshake s...

Page 7: ...o grasp They demonstrate in depth serial port programming in a variety of languages but they are also useful tools for using serial devices Comtest exe Comtest is a short but invaluable program that i...

Page 8: ...ual device drivers providing the shared ssvel vxd ssmult vxd ssm485 vxd interrupt handlers and dispatch routines etc for the various Serial Solutions serial cards Serial Solutions For Windows NT Windo...

Page 9: ...face to configure cards and their ports under Device Manager Multi port serial adapters SsCard hlp The help file for the SsCard dll user interface Complete Documentation and Technical Backup We believ...

Page 10: ...t 15m and beyond Word length of 5 6 7 or 8 bits Even Odd None Mark or Space parity options 1 start bit always sent 1 1 5 for 5 bit data word length or 2 stop bits Full modem control TXD RXD DSR DCD DT...

Page 11: ...1 Port RS232 Card Chapter 2 8 Configuring PCI Cards PCI cards by definition require no hardware configuration and can be installed directly from the box...

Page 12: ...r removing any interface board STEP 1 Remove Cover Mounting Screws Then using a screwdriver remove the cover mounting screws on the back panel of the PC system unit STEP 2 Remove The PC Cover Next rem...

Page 13: ...w safely for later STEP 4 Insert The Card Now insert the card in the slot Be careful to ensure that the gold plated pcb fingers fits neatly into the I O expansion connector Press down firmly but evenl...

Page 14: ...normal way Problems If the system fails to power up normally check the following 1 Ensure that the PC Serial card is installed correctly 2 Ensure that other cards in the PC have not been upset 3 Ensu...

Page 15: ......

Page 16: ...supplied disk BBCARDS EXE will return a string that looks similar to the following values contained in the string may differ in individual PC s due to resource availability card 1 is on bus 0 device...

Page 17: ...transmits irrespective of the handshake lines The 3 wires are TxD RxD and Ground no other lines are required Thus the CTS DSR and DCD inputs are ignored The RTS and DTR output lines are set true just...

Page 18: ...n assembled the NEWCOM SYS command line looks like DEVICE NEWCOM SYS A5 0140 I 11 5 B5 S 512 H 4 and should be entered into the CONFIG SYS file Once you are sure that these parameters have been entere...

Page 19: ......

Page 20: ...EXE from the supplied Serial Solutions CDROM Place the supplied Serial Solutions CDROM disk in a suitable drive From File Manager choose Run and enter Drive diskimg ssutil pci bbcards where drive is t...

Page 21: ...onents are installed For further details on the Component Options consult the README TXT file on the supplied disk If only logical ports COM1 to COM9 are to be used then de select the Comms API librar...

Page 22: ...1 Port RS232 Card Chapter 5 19 Serial Port Installation From Main double click Control Panel Double click on Serial Ports Click on the add button...

Page 23: ...is 8 higher than the previous i e if COM2 has an address of 0140h then COM3 has an address of 0148h In the IRQ field enter the value 11 Note The values used in the above section were those returned b...

Page 24: ...o configure and click on Settings the following dialogue will be displayed Note A port that has been added has the default values of Baud Rate 9600 Data Bits 8 Parity None top Bits 1 0 Flow None Chang...

Page 25: ...from the system Note Never try to leave out a serial port number when using the delete button because Windows may automatically shift serial port numbers which results in a mis match of settings in t...

Page 26: ...1 Port RS232 Card Chapter 5 23 made ALL the necessary changes restart Windows so that the new settings come into effect...

Page 27: ......

Page 28: ...he Driver During the booting process Windows 95 will detect the PCI 1 Port RS232 Card but will display it simply as a PCI CARD and you will briefly see a message box to this effect Windows will then d...

Page 29: ...e shows that the Update Device Driver Wizard has found a suitable driver and the location of that driver Click Finish Click OK In the location space type drive diskimg sswin9x where drive is the appro...

Page 30: ...32 card will appear under the Multi function adapters branch Also a Communications Port will appear under the Ports COM LPT branch For most users who have 4 or less COM ports the new port will appear...

Page 31: ...1 Port RS232 Card Chapter 6 28 Click on the Device Manager tab...

Page 32: ...e the I O address and interrupt and is usually used only for legacy devices which require specific settings This is an advanced feature which should only be tackled by experieced users In this window...

Page 33: ...ick on the My Computer icon on your desktop Click on Properties Double clicking on the Ports COM LPT label you will reveal a list of ports installed on your machine Click on the port you wish to confi...

Page 34: ...maximum value selectable is 921 600 this is due to standard Windows COM port drivers being used Data Bits Parity Stop Bits Flow Control Change to suit the remote device being used Restore Defaults wh...

Page 35: ...l allow the interrupt to be serviced quicker which is good for slow machines If you have a fast machine setting a high value will give you more time for multi tasking operations Transmit Buffer These...

Page 36: ...sert the PCI 1 Rs232 Card into your PC as described in Chapter 3 Installing the Card and restart Driver Installation During the booting process Windows 98 will detect the PCI 1 port RS232 but will dis...

Page 37: ...where drive is the appropriate letter for your CDROM drive Click Next Click Finish After copying the file Windows 95 will then detect each of the serial ports in turn and install them as communication...

Page 38: ...the Ports COM LPT branch For most users who have 4 or less COM ports the new port will appear as COM5 as pictured above for users with more than 5 COM ports the new port will appear as the first avail...

Page 39: ...y double clicking on the Multi function adapters label you will reveal any cards that you have installed Click on the PCI 1 Port RS232 Card label to highlight it then click on the Properties button Cl...

Page 40: ...port assignment may be changed simply by selecting a new COM port value from the pull down menu relevant to the port However COM port usage other than those for the PCI 1 Port RS232 card itself are no...

Page 41: ...on your machine Click on the port you wish to configure to configure to highlight it then click on the Properties button Selecting the Port Settings tab produces Settings available in these windows a...

Page 42: ...y recommended that the FIFO for both ports is left enabled Receive Buffer These settings allow the selection of a receiver FIFO trigger setting Selecting a low value will allow the interrupt to be ser...

Page 43: ......

Page 44: ...ministrator level privileges if you do not have these please contact your system administrator Insert the PCI 1 Rs232 Card into your PC as described in Chapter 3 Installing the Card and restart Driver...

Page 45: ...RS232 Card Chapter 8 42 InstallShield will then install the driver software as shown below Click Next Checking Your Installation Open the Control panel by clicking on Start then Settings then Control...

Page 46: ...uble click on Serial Solutions icon This window will show the Card and the ports which have been installed by the Serial Solutions driver Port Configuration Open the Control panel by clicking on Start...

Page 47: ...ch you wish to configure by clicking on it s label Click the Properties button Select the Port Settings tab Settings available in these windows are Bits per second determines the baud rate at which th...

Page 48: ...th ports is left enabled Receive Trigger Level These settings allow the selection of a receiver FIFO trigger setting Selecting a low value will allow the interrupt to be serviced quicker which is good...

Page 49: ...rol Panel open the Add Remove Programs applet then close the Control Panel Select from the list Serial Solutions PCI Click the Add Remove button Windows NT will then uninstall the Serial Solutions PCI...

Page 50: ...under Windows2000 you must be logged in as a user with Administrator level privileges if you do not have these please contact your system administrator Insert the PCI 1 Rs232 Card into your PC as desc...

Page 51: ...ter 8 48 Select Search for a suitable driver for my device Click Next Select Specify a location Click Next Type drive diskimg sswin2k where drive is the letter of the CDROM drive containing the Serial...

Page 52: ...1 Port RS232 Card Chapter 8 49 Click Next Click Yes Click Finish The Brain Boxes serial port will now be installed and messages will flash on the screen to indicate that this is happening...

Page 53: ...on click on the My Computer icon on your desktop Click on Properties Select the Hardware Tab Click on the Device Manager Button The PCI 1 port RS232 card will appear under Multi port serial adapters A...

Page 54: ...rt RS232 Card Chapter 8 51 Card Configuration Using the right hand mouse button click on the My Computer icon on your desktop Click on Properties Select the Hardware Tab Click on the Device Manager Bu...

Page 55: ...ndow the COM port assignment may be changed simply by selecting a new COM port value from the pull down menu relevant to the port However COM port usage other than those for the PCI 1 Port RS232 card...

Page 56: ...quicker which is good for slow machines If you have a fast machine setting a high value will give you more time for multi tasking operations Software Transmit Level These settings allow the selection...

Page 57: ...he Device Manager Button Double clicking on the Ports COM LPT label you will reveal a list of ports installed on your machine Double click on the port you wish to configure Select the Port Settings ta...

Page 58: ...though the maximum value selectable is 921 600 this is due to standard Windows COM port drivers being used Data Bits Parity Stop Bits Flow Control Change to suit the remote device being used Restore D...

Page 59: ......

Page 60: ...computer industry terms Introduced in 1962 it is now widely established RS232 is a slow speed short distance single ended transmission system i e only one wire per signal Typical RS232 maximum cable l...

Page 61: ...r device Traditionally making up the cross over cable has been considered a black art However provided you have the pin outs and handshake requirements of both sides of your RS232 connection the cross...

Page 62: ...This allows the receiving device to signal when it can no longer accept data The receiving device sets DTR false when it is unable to receive any more data The sending device reads DTR on its CTS and...

Page 63: ...ter 8 60 9 Pin D Serial Port Loop Back Connector A loop back connector can be used to echo RS232 data transmitted by a serial port back into its own RS232 receiver In this way the function of the seri...

Page 64: ...D CONNECTOR 9 To 25 Way Adapter This adapter cable makes the AT style 9 pin serial port look like the standard PC 25 pin serial port It is NOT a cross over cable 9 Pin AT SERIAL PORT 25 Pin PC SERIAL...

Page 65: ...1 Port RS232 Card Chapter 8 62...

Page 66: ...3 x 17 device driver 13 14 DOS 13 DSR 3 7 59 DTR 3 7 59 E emulation 4 F FIFO 3 7 H handshake 3 58 HARDWARE 3 I installation 5 interrupts 4 L loop back 4 57 60 M Millenium 33 mode 4 modem 7 N NEWCOM S...

Page 67: ...1 Port RS232 Card Index 64...

Reviews: